123. Qantas to Open Split-Level Dedicated Airport Lounge at London Heathrow
Qantas is to begin construction on a new airport lounge at London Heathrow Airport in September 2016. The premium lounge will occupy a split-level space in Terminal 3 that will have capacity for approximately 230 people. It will offer views over the Heathrow airfield when it opens in early 2017.
124. Accor Signs Three Hotels in Phuket, Thailand
AccorHotels and Avista Resort and Spa Patong Company Limited have signed an agreement for AccorHotels to manage three properties in Phuket. Two resorts will be rebranded as Novotel Phuket Kata Avista Resort and Spa and Avista Hidewaway Phuket Patong, MGallery by Sofitel on 1 April 2016, while another newly-built Avista Grande Phuket Karon, MGallery by Sofitel will open in 2018.
